National leader Judith Collins has spoken up for a columnist who was stripped of her guns over a tweet police considered to be threatening .
Rachel Stewart, who has written for Stuff and
NZ Herald, lashed out on Twitter in May amid debate over Speak Up For Women, a group opposed to gender self-identification, being blocked from hosting a speaking event in Christchurch.
Stewart, in response to Speak Up For Women supporters being labelled grubs on Twitter by an advocate who accused them of being anti-transgender, responded with a tweet that police considered to be threatening. Is it wrong that the country girl in me wants to invite my gun-toting sisters over, strip this wee f er naked, let him loose in the back paddock, jump on the tray of the ute, and hunt him down with spotlights while whooping & hollering & drinking?
Stewart posted screenshots showing that Twitter did not take action. Police did take action, however, after receiving a complaint. Stewart said two officers showed up at her home and removed her firearms, licence and ammunition.
